      Temporary solution
      Type from console and find HAVP and CLAM string:

      pkg_info

      Delete havp and clamav ports

      pkg_delete havp-xVersionNumx
      pkg_delete clamav-xVersionNumx
      (nothing more to do)

      Check you FreeBSD version

      uname -a

      Take one url for you FreeBSD version (7x or 8x):

      ftp://ftp.freebsd.org/pub/FreeBSD/ports/i386/packages-8.0-release/All/havp-0.91.tbz
      ftp://ftp.freebsd.org/pub/FreeBSD/ports/i386/packages-7.3-release/All/havp-0.91.tbz
      ftp://ftp.freebsd.org/pub/FreeBSD/ports/i386/packages-7.2-release/All/havp-0.90.tbz
      

      Type from console:

      pkg_add -r havp-URL

      Then, go to HAVP GUI and press SAVE. Open settings tab and update AV database (wait 10-30 min).

      That's all.
